Hydraulic line rollers - safe and smooth guidance
Hydraulic hose rollers guide and protect the hoses, allowing them to move smoothly with the movement of the machinery. They prevent bending and damage to the hoses, ensuring the reliability and long life of hydraulic systems.

The importance of hydraulic hose rollers
- Hose protection: Hydraulic hose rollers protect the hoses from mechanical damage, which is crucial for the long-term and trouble-free operation of hydraulic systems.
- Smoothness of movement: Enable the hoses to move smoothly, which is important for efficient machine operation and minimising the risk of jamming.
- Wear reduction: They reduce friction between the hoses and other machine components, which extends the life of the hoses and reduces the need for frequent replacements.
How do hydraulic line rollers work?
Hydraulic line rollers are installed at strategic locations on the machine to guide and support the hydraulic lines as the mast and arms move. Here are some key aspects of hydraulic line rollers:
- Hose routing: Rollers keep the hydraulic lines in the correct path, preventing accidental movement and jamming.
- Swivel bearings: Equipped with bearings, the rollers allow free rotation to reduce friction and wear on the cables.
- Durable materials: The rollers are made of wear- and corrosion-resistant materials to ensure long-lasting and reliable performance.
